Through extensive personal physical training, you have learned to draw upon your body's inner strength in ways that make you more effective in fast-paced martial combat. This strength is Monk-like in nature. You can use Dexterity instead of Strength for the attack and damage rolls of your unarmed strikes, and you can roll a d4 in place of the normal damage of your unarmed strike. Also, while you are wearing no armor and not wielding a shield, you gain the following benefits:
- Add +1 to your AC. Also, your speed increases by 5 feet.
- When you use the Attack action with an unarmed strike, or a monk weapon (a shortsword or any simple melee weapon that doesn't have the two-handed or heavy property) that you are proficient with, you can make one unarmed strike as a bonus action.
- During your turn, you can take the Dodge, Disengage or Dash action as a bonus action. Your jump distance is also doubled during that turn. You can use this ability a number of times equal to your proficiency bonus, and you regain all expended uses when you finish a long rest.
